Pan-Arabism

Pan-Arabism is an ideology espousing the unification – or, sometimes, close cooperation and solidarity against perceived enemies of the Arabs – of the countries of the Arab world, from the Atlantic Ocean to the Arabian Sea. It is closely connected to Arab nationalism, which asserts that the Arabs constitute a single nation. Its popularity was at its height during the 1950s and 1960s.
